The Mechanics of Spin: From Grip to Release

The foundation of effective spin bowling lies in a complex interplay of biomechanics. While variations exist between different types of spin – leg spin, off spin, left-arm orthodox, and slow left-arm chinaman – the core principles remain consistent. The grip is paramount, dictating the amount of spin that can be imparted on the ball. A firm yet relaxed grip allows the bowler to manipulate the seam position, influencing the direction of the spin. The wrist plays a vital role, acting as the fulcrum for generating turn and delivering variations in flight. Ultimately, the bowler attempts to create an illusion, deceiving the batsman into misreading the ball's trajectory and spin.

The Role of the Seam

The seam of the cricket ball is a crucial element in generating spin. By manipulating the seam position at the point of release, bowlers can influence the amount of deviation and bounce the ball experiences. A well-maintained seam provides a greater surface area for the fingers to grip, enhancing the bowler's control over spin. The angle of the seam also affects the ball's flight path, making it more difficult for the batsman to judge its trajectory. A subtle change in seam position can result in a significant difference in the ball's behavior, turning a seemingly innocuous delivery into a potent wicket-taking threat. Understanding and utilizing the seam effectively is a hallmark of a truly skilled spin bowler.

Spin Type Grip Characteristics Seam Angle Typical Effect
Leg Spin Fingers across the seam, imparting clockwise rotation (for a right-arm bowler). Slightly angled to the right. Turns away from the right-handed batsman.
Off Spin Fingers around the seam, imparting anti-clockwise rotation. Slightly angled to the left. Turns into the right-handed batsman.

The table above highlights the fundamental differences in grip and seam angle between leg and off-spin, demonstrating how these seemingly small adjustments can dramatically alter the ball's trajectory. Mastering these nuances is the key to unlocking a bowler’s deceptive potential.

Developing Variations: Beyond Traditional Spin

While the basic principles of spin bowling remain consistent, the modern game demands a broader repertoire of variations. Bowlers who rely solely on traditional spin are increasingly vulnerable to aggressive batsmen who are adept at reading the ball from the hand. The development of variations – such as the googly, topspin, and slider – allows bowlers to disrupt the batsman’s rhythm and create doubt. These variations often involve subtle changes to the wrist position, finger pressure, and release point, creating different flight paths and spin trajectories. The goal is to keep the batsman guessing and prevent them from settling into a comfortable pattern.

The Impact of Pitch Conditions on Spin Bowling

The surface on which the game is played plays a significant role in the effectiveness of spin bowling. Dry, crumbling pitches offer greater assistance to spin bowlers, as the ball grips the surface and turns more sharply. Conversely, grassy or wet pitches tend to negate spin, as the ball skids on through without much deviation. Understanding the pitch conditions and adapting the bowling strategy accordingly is crucial. Bowlers may need to adjust their length, pace, and the amount of spin they impart on the ball to maximize its effectiveness. The ability to read the pitch and exploit its characteristics is a hallmark of a skilled and intelligent spin bowler.

Adapting to Different Surfaces

On spin-friendly pitches, bowlers can focus on exploiting the turn and bounce to create dismissals. This often involves pitching the ball on a good length and letting the surface do the rest. On unresponsive surfaces, bowlers may need to rely more on variations in pace and flight, or to bowl a tighter line to prevent easy boundaries. The key is to be adaptable and willing to adjust the strategy based on the pitch conditions. A bowler who can consistently perform well on a variety of surfaces is a valuable asset to any team. Successful adaptation proves the bowler's understanding of the complex interaction between ball, pitch, and technique.

The Evolution of Batting Techniques Against Spin

As spin bowling has evolved, so too have batting techniques. Modern batsmen are becoming increasingly adept at reading spin from the hand, sweeping effectively, and using their feet to get to the pitch of the ball. This necessitates a constant evolution in spin bowling, with bowlers needing to develop new variations and strategies to stay ahead of the game. The rise of aggressive batting styles, such as the reverse sweep and the paddle scoop, has also challenged traditional spin bowling tactics, requiring bowlers to think outside the box and adapt their approach. The continual battle between bat and ball is what makes cricket such a fascinating sport.
